#d1a404 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#d1a404 is composed of 82% red, 64.3% green and 1.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 21.5% magenta, 98.1% yellow and 18% black. It has a hue angle of 46.8 degrees, a saturation of 96.2% and a lightness of 41.8%. #d1a404 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ff08 with #a34900. Closest websafe color is: #cc9900.

#d1a404 color description : Strong yellow.

#d1a404 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#d1a404 has RGB values of R:209, G:164, B:4 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.22, Y:0.98, K:0.18. Its decimal value is 13739012.

Hex triplet d1a404 #d1a404
RGB Decimal 209, 164, 4 rgb(209,164,4)
RGB Percent 82, 64.3, 1.6 rgb(82%,64.3%,1.6%)
CMYK 0, 22, 98, 18
HSL 46.8°, 96.2, 41.8 hsl(46.8,96.2%,41.8%)
HSV (or HSB) 46.8°, 98.1, 82
Web Safe cc9900 #cc9900
CIE-LAB 69.553, 4.656, 72.37
XYZ 39.593, 40.117, 5.773
xyY 0.463, 0.469, 40.117
CIE-LCH 69.553, 72.52, 86.319
CIE-LUV 69.553, 38.519, 72.173
Hunter-Lab 63.338, 0.739, 38.933
Binary 11010001, 10100100, 00000100

Shades and Tints of #d1a404

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#110d00 is the darkest color, while #fffefc is the lightest one.

Tones of #d1a404

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#6f6d66 is the less saturated color, while #d1a404 is the most saturated one.

Color Blindness Simulator

Below, you can see how #d1a404 is perceived by people affected by a color vision deficiency. This can be useful if you need to ensure your color combinations are accessible to color-blind users.

Monochromacy
  • #9f9f9f Achromatopsia 0.005% of the population
  • #a9a080 Atypical Achromatopsia 0.001% of the population
Dichromacy
  • #c3ae12 Protanopia 1% of men
  • #daa515 Deuteranopia 1% of men
  • #dc9da8 Tritanopia 0.001% of the population
Trichromacy
  • #c8aa0d Protanomaly 1% of men, 0.01% of women
  • #d6a50f Deuteranomaly 6% of men, 0.4% of women
  • #d89f6c Tritanomaly 0.01% of the population
